+# Docker doesn't require the IDs you run as to exist in
+# the container's /etc/passwd & /etc/group files, but
+# if they do not, then libvirt's 'make check' will fail
+# many tests.
+#
+# We do not directly mount /etc/{passwd,group} as Docker
+# is liable to mess with SELinux labelling which will
+# then prevent the host accessing them. Copying them
+# first is safer.
+CI_PWDB_MOUNTS = \
+ --volume $(CI_SCRATCHDIR)/group:/etc/group:ro,z \
+ --volume $(CI_SCRATCHDIR)/passwd:/etc/passwd:ro,z \
+ $(NULL)
+
+# Docker containers can have very large ulimits
+# for nofiles - as much as 1048576. This makes
+# libvirt very slow at exec'ing programs.
+CI_ULIMIT_FILES = 1024

+# Args to use when cloning a git repo.
+# -c stop it complaining about checking out a random hash
+# -q stop it displaying progress info for local clone
+# --local ensure we don't actually copy files
+CI_GIT_ARGS = \
+ -c advice.detachedHead=false \
+ -q \
+ --local \
+ $(NULL)
+
+# Args to use when running the Docker env
+# --rm stop inactive containers getting left behind
+# --user we execute as the same user & group account
+# as dev so that file ownership matches host
+# instead of root:root
+# --volume to pass in the cloned git repo & config
+# --workdir to set cwd to vpath build location
+# --ulimit lower files limit for performance reasons
+# --interactive
+# --tty Ensure we have ability to Ctrl-C the build
+CI_DOCKER_ARGS = \
+ --rm \
+ --user $(CI_UID):$(CI_GID) \
+ --interactive \
+ --tty \
+ $(CI_PWDB_MOUNTS) \
+ --volume $(CI_HOST_SRCDIR):$(CI_CONT_SRCDIR):z \
+ --workdir $(CI_CONT_SRCDIR) \
+ --ulimit nofile=$(CI_ULIMIT_FILES):$(CI_ULIMIT_FILES) \
+ $(NULL)
